Hydrogen is inefficient. First, you have to put it huge amount of energy to split water which has losses. Then converting it back to electricity too has losses. You could have used the same energy to charge a battery instead which are like 95% efficient.
This is one of the most important factor other than the issues with hydrogen generation, storage, and safety challenges.
Latest Answers